Areola reduction surgery is a safe and simple procedure that can reduce the diameter of one or both of your areolas. It can be performed on its own or in combination with a breast lift, breast reduction, or breast augmentation. This procedure is also popular with our clients who have recently undergone pregnancy or lost a significant amount of weight, leaving them with misshapen areolas.

Your nipple and areola reduction surgery can be performed in-office under local anesthesia. If performed in combination with another breast or body surgery, you will likely require general anesthesia at our surgery center in Nashville. After the area is numb, Dr. MaDan will remove the outer excess of the pigmented, areolar tissue. Usually, the desired areola diameter is 38 – 42 mm, however this may be customized by you. Placement of the incision at the border of the skin and areola allows for easy scar concealment. Your new areola will be secured with a suture deep inside the breast, which will prevent the areola from widening and stretching. Dissolvable stitches will then be used to close the incision site. In most cases, you will be cleared to go home almost immediately after surgery. However, the general breast surgery recovery period is usually two weeks before you can resume normal activity. Make sure you schedule lots of time for rest and relaxation and have lots of help around the house. Exercise and heavy lifting should be avoided for about two weeks after your procedure.
